Amelia grew up near the Royal Capital, the place for the prosperous and pure-blooded, where hunger or poverty is only a spine-chiller. Since Amelia's Family is neither wealthy, nor of noble descent she has to live at the outer Areas of the capital but still Close enough to be constantly reminded of their differences. Thus she hates every single one of those oh so fancy pure bloods and especially the Royal Dragon Family, which lives in the Center of the Capital in a ginormous Castle. Never would she have imagined that her Sentiments for them could be changed until she meets the royal prince Jared himself.
